Momaday - Nike-Hercules Actual Brent (13.64%)
in cm in cm Vendor
-----------------------------------------
Booster diamater (OD) 16.57 42.09 2.26 5.74 LOC
Booster diamater (ID) - - 2.14 5.44 LOC
Top of transition diameter 33.00 83.82 4.50 11.43
Top of bevel diameter 25.38 64.46 3.46 8.79
Transition height 27.38 69.53 3.73 9.48
Bevel height 5.81 14.76 0.79 2.01
Booster interface height 5.28 13.41 0.72 1.83
Length of booster and nozzle 130.47 331.39 17.79 45.20
Length of fairing (from bottom) 27.98 71.06 3.82 9.69
Length of boat tail transition 51.63 131.13 7.04 17.88
Length of sustainer (to point) 299.13 759.78 40.80 103.63
Sustainer diameter (OD) 31.50 80.01 4.30 10.91
Sustainer diameter (ID) - - - -
Length of nose (from point) 136.00 345.44 18.55 47.11
Length of nose (from top) 133.50 339.09 18.21 46.25
Total length (to top) 464.56 1,179.98 63.36 160.94
